What triggers being allowed to go with the guy to the Hengorot? He keeps saying I'm not powerfull enough. Do you have to reach a certain level? Do you need to complete IWD before you can start HOW? Inquiring minds want to know, Thanks!!

Aerich 08-20-2004 04:38 AM

I assume you are referring to the shaman in Kuldahar who takes you to HoW? Each of your characters has to be at least level eight. That's including combined levels - you can go through with a lvl 4/4 multiclassed character, although I wouldn't recommend it. The level requirement also goes up with the difficulty level.

You do not have to complete IWD before starting HoW. However, I would at least finish the Severed Hand before doing so. That area is stacked with good spells and items that you will want in HoW.

silencer 08-24-2004 02:30 AM

Since you said Hengorot and not HoW I would guess you meant the scenario of getting thrown out of the camp. You need to pass through Burial Isle (speak to the fisherman in Lonelywood) and Gloomfrost, then revisit the guard upon which a new dialog appears.

<font color = mediumspringgreen>I thought clvl requirements were a little higher. I am pretty sure there is a minimum character clvl AND a minimum average party clvl, and it may be class dependent. It's confusing, and I have never seen a definitive and authoritative explanation of what the exact requirements are; but it is a moot point, because: Unless you are a masochist, you do NOT want to enter HoW with a party that is anywhere NEAR the minimum allowed! Your party should AVERAGE AT LEAST clvl 11 (9/10 for DC characters). Make no mistake, going into HoW with a party full of level 9 characters will lead to a very frustrating experience, very early on. Make sure you have at least one high-level priest (clvl 12+) with active skills (not inactivated because you have DCed and have not progressed far enough in your second skill set): Burial Isle is one of the first places you visit in HoW, and I think it was specifically designed to spank priestless parties. </font>

<font color = mediumspringgreen>Very good advice. Even better advice is to go as far as possible in IWD before trying HoW: Remember that HoW is designed to be difficult for parties of six that have completely finished IWD and average clvl 12; so load your guys with as much expo as possible. Get your party to the point where lower DD is totally cleaned out; you have defeated the stone idol and you could progress up the stairs to RBP's chamber (don't); and you have the Dorn's items requested in the Severed Hand quest. THEN go back to Severed hand and collect your 400,000 in expo (if you get all requested items). If that is enough expo, go to Kuldahar and start HoW. If you want more expo, first, (e.g., to nudge that 9/11 DC Fighter/Priest up to 9/12) go back to LDD and whack the respawning monsters.

Second, going to the Barbarian camp:

All that I would add to what silencer has said is: Do everything in your power to avoid any fight in the Barb camp, unless and until you know exactly, BEFORE you enter the camp, why you might want to do otherwise. If you get into a fight on your first visit, you did something wrong. And if you kill the guard at the Barb camp gate, you are shafted: cannot finish the game.
